Basement Remodeling – Transforming a Fairfield Connecticut Basement Into a Living Space

When it comes to maximizing your home’s value and functionality, finishing your basement can be a game-changer. Not only can it increase your property’s worth, but it also provides an opportunity to create new living areas, generate rental income, or even add an extra bedroom for guests. However, before embarking on a basement remodeling project, there are several key factors to consider.

First and foremost, it is crucial to assess the amount of space available in your basement. Understanding the dimensions of the area will allow you to plan and design accordingly. However, be mindful that most building codes and regulations require a minimum ceiling height of seven feet for a basement to be suitable for remodeling and finishing. Failure to comply with these requirements may result in costly setbacks and potential safety hazards.

One critical step in the basement remodeling journey involves installing insulation. Proper insulation is vital for creating a comfortable and energy-efficient living space. It helps regulate temperature and reduce noise transmission, transforming your basement into a cozy retreat. Furthermore, insulation contributes to long-term cost savings by minimizing heating and cooling expenses.

Moisture protection is another significant consideration when renovating a basement. Living in a basement requires implementing vapor barriers to prevent moisture from seeping through concrete walls. By installing this protective layer, you can safeguard your basement against potential water damage and mold growth. This step is essential for ensuring the longevity and structural integrity of your newly transformed living space.

Integrating a sump pump into your basement design is also crucial. This device plays a vital role in managing water accumulation and preventing flooding. By channeling excess water away from the foundation, a sump pump protects your basement from potential water damage. Consequently, incorporating this feature should be a priority when brainstorming basement living space ideas.

Amidst your basement remodeling journey, it is essential to prioritize safety. Egress windows, in addition to providing natural light, serve as emergency escape routes. According to basement building codes, these windows are vital for creating a safe and secure environment. They offer peace of mind, ensuring that occupants can swiftly exit the basement in case of fire or other emergencies.

Lastly, it is imperative to inspect for radon gas. Radon is a colorless, odorless gas that can accumulate in basements, posing severe health risks. Conducting a thorough radon inspection is essential for the well-being of future residents and should not be overlooked during the remodeling process. Identifying and addressing this issue promptly will ensure a healthy and safe living environment.
